I had some conversations with a small designer and manufacturer that was interested. I set up for them to contact Purism (or vice versa). I have not heard from them since (it’s been a few weeks now). This is too bad. I think they ran out of faith.

They had a plan to manufacture a mold (the most expensive thing, five figures easily) relatively cheap but still did not believe that the numbers were there (which I disagree but have no proof of). They even had an idea to source recycled plastics, possibly with wood fiber mix and could have made a few variants. But, I feel, they did not believe there would be enough customers. The last thing I did, was to send an email about the possibility of a Kickstarter (either by them - or by more experienced Purism) to see if the pre-orders would be there, but it’s been silence. It could be that they thought this was after all some scam and not a real opportunity.

Quick calculations: for minimum of 30000 coins (they need at least some profit for incentive - and some manufacturers are more expensive), they would need to sell at least 1200 cases at average of 25 coins (not including Purism possibly supporting this). Individual customer also would have to pay for shipping and all that on top of it. So, not a cheap thing, there is risk involved.
